Worry

A trembling streetlight,
at the corner of Elm and Main
and
one fallen of the night
on the offensive,
reason omitted.

Her smiling mask
over a sour storm,
the sinking saga
of the howling wolves,
seeing limited.

Marginal demands,
gold mine drained,
designs strained,
clumsy pagan hands
a play never ending...

Through the dark I call her to say:
”Do not remain lingering
in between two empties:
an empty, which is not there,
and an empty that exists.”

This quenchless rain,
looting her mind,
she shrugs, a ruin charred,
her ashes
spilling.

What if she finds her way
where the swing-bridge is?
If only I could manage to escape
without mourning
her life!
